  CGWICs Long March-3B rocket has successfully launched Hong-Kong's APT Satellite Company Ltd APSTAR 7 satellite weighing 5054kg from the Chinese Xichang Satellite Launch Center. The lift-off occured at 10:27 and after 36 minutes mission the satellite was successfully separated to . APSTAR 7 has 28 C and 28 Ku-band transponders and will replace the aging APSTAR 2R satellite at 76.5 East longitude.       More info: http://cn.cgwic.com/APSTAR-7/index.html
